Summary

For Year 2025-26, MAS Financial Services reports the following shareholding: Total Promoters at 66.63%, Mutual Fund at 13.91%, Insurance at 0.51%, Foreign Institutional Investors at 3.13%, Domestic Institutional Investors at 5.82%, and Retail at 10%. This breakdown provides a quick snapshot of ownership distribution for MAS Financial Services in 2025-26.

As of 02-2026, the promoter shareholding in MAS Financial Services stands at 66.63% of the company's total shares. Promoter shareholding represents the ownership stake held by the company's founding members, management, or controlling entities, having a significant influence on the company's strategic direction and operations.

The FII and DII shareholding of MAS Financial Services is 3.13% and 5.82% respectively.

The retail shareholding of the MAS Financial Services is 10%.

Changes in shareholding patterns of MAS Financial Services can result from stock market transactions, issuance of new shares, buybacks, mergers, acquisitions, or changes in promoter holdings.

Shareholding patterns of MAS Financial Services are updated quarterly as mandated by regulatory authorities and may also be disclosed during significant corporate events.

The latest shareholding pattern is available on stock exchanges (e.g., NSE, BSE) and the company's official website under investor relations.
